IP4 4HG lies on Hutland Road in Ipswich. IP4 4HG is located in the Rushmere electoral ward, within the local authority district of Ipswich and the English Parliamentary constituency of Ipswich.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Suffolk and North East Essex ICB - 06L and the police force is Suffolk.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
